Taylor Larkin
United States
Taylor Larkin, American professional poker player, world ranking 8658, with cumulative earnings over $390,000. Known for his solid play, he has achieved good results in multiple tournaments.
Player Overview
Taylor Larkin is a poker player from the United States, currently ranked 8658th in the world, with career earnings exceeding $390,000. He has demonstrated consistent competitive performance in numerous poker events.
Career & Major Results
Taylor Larkin's poker career began in online tournaments, later transitioning to live events. He has cashed in various tournaments multiple times, accumulating earnings over $390,000. Specific event names and results are not publicly available due to limited information.
Playing Style
Taylor Larkin is known for being conservative and solid, adept at using position advantage for value betting. He focuses on hand reading and opponent tendency analysis, rarely engaging in high-risk bluffs.
